Tips for Selecting a Dedicated Development Team

Tips for Selecting a Dedicated Development Team

1. Define Your Project Requirements

The first step in selecting a dedicated development team is to define your project requirements. You need to have a clear understanding of what you want your software to do, what features you require, and what technology stack you will be using.

2. Evaluate the Team’s Portfolio

When evaluating a potential dedicated development team, it is important to review their portfolio. You should look for teams that have a proven track record of delivering high-quality software on time and within budget. You can also check out their client reviews and testimonials to get an idea of their work ethic and communication skills.

3. Check for Technical Expertise

Technical expertise is critical when selecting a dedicated development team. You need to ensure that the team you select has the necessary technical skills and experience to deliver your project successfully. This includes proficiency in programming languages, databases, frameworks, and other technologies that are relevant to your project.

4. Communication is Key

Effective communication is essential when working with a dedicated development team. You need to ensure that the team you select has excellent communication skills and is willing to work closely with you throughout the project. This includes providing regular updates on progress, discussing any issues or concerns, and being responsive to your feedback.

5. Choose a Team That Shares Your Vision

When selecting a dedicated development team, it is important to choose a team that shares your vision for the project. You want a team that is passionate about delivering high-quality software and is committed to achieving your project goals. This includes teams that are willing to take risks, think outside the box, and come up with innovative solutions to problems.

6. Consider Cultural Differences

When working with a dedicated development team, it is important to consider cultural differences. You need to ensure that the team you select has a similar work ethic, values, and communication style as your organization. This will help to avoid any misunderstandings or conflicts that could arise due to cultural differences.

7. Review Contracts and Agreements

When working with a dedicated development team, it is important to review contracts and agreements carefully. You need to ensure that the terms of the agreement are clearly defined and that both parties have a clear understanding of their responsibilities and obligations. This includes issues such as payment terms, timelines, deliverables, and termination clauses.

Conclusion

In conclusion, selecting a dedicated development team can be a challenging task, but by following these tips, you can increase your chances of finding the right team for your project. Remember to define your project requirements, evaluate the team’s portfolio, check for technical expertise, communicate effectively, choose a team that shares your vision, consider cultural differences, and review contracts and agreements carefully.